Homeland:
The Complete Fifth Season (2016/20th Century Fox Blu-ray Set)
Picture:
B Sound: C+ Extras: B Episodes; B+
Even
when Carrie (Claire Danes) is out of the game, she still finds her
way in... where she wants to or not. When an American journalist
discovers a conspiracy between American and German intelligence
agencies it kick starts a chain reaction that threatens the entire
safety of Eastern Europe. Carrie finds herself in the middle of
another imminent terrorist attack, she becomes a both a target and
liability ...and she is the only one who can stop them in Homeland:
The Complete Fifth Season (2016).
After
the embarrassing fiasco/PR nightmare, Saul must deal with the
aftermath that their entire European spy network is compromised.
That America have been illegally spying on behalf of German
government (because it's illegal for one's own government to spy on
it's own people) to hunt and assassinate terrorists.
Anti-governments and terrorists take the opportunity to move and
attain WMD (weapons of mass destruction) and further their causes.
Unfortunately for Carrie, neither the agency or terrorists believe
Carrie is NOT connected to these events, she must not only deal with
terrorists but find a double agent (who also want her dead) who has
compromised the intelligence agency and threaten the lives of
thousands.

Presented
in 1080p high definition with a widescreen aspect ratio of 1.78:1 and
a lossless DTS-Master Audio 5.1 track, the picture is in keeping with
the way the show looked, but the sound is disappointing at times.
Extras include The
Evolution of Carrie Mathison
and Homeland
in Berlin: Beyond the Wall.
Episodes
this time around are (with some spoilers)...
Separation
Anxiety - Carrie attempts to live a civilian life as a security
contractor. There is a massive leak in the CIA Germany branch of
classified documents and illegal American activities.
The
Tradition of Hospitality - Carrie averts an assassination
attempt, only to discover she was the true target. Saul is the
middle of a headhunting crisis in who is to blame for the leak in the
intelligence agency.
Superpowers
- Carrie attempts to find out who is trying to kill her. The media
has a field day with Laura and her classified documents.
Why
is This Night Different? - Saul attempts to stabilize things
between Europe and the Middle East only to literally have it blown up
in his face.
Better
Call Saul - Carrie goes dark and fakes her own death, she
discovers Allison is the one who ordered her assassination.
Parabiosis
- Carrie attempts to tell Saul what she discovered and her theory.
Saul begins to suspect Allison.
Oriole
- Allison begins to suspect Carrie is alive. Carrie, Laura and Numan
goes over the leaked documents in search of clues. Saul is abducted.
All
About Allison - As Carrie negotiates with Allison she realizes
Allison is a double agent and a mole for Russia. Quinn discovers
WMDs, chemical weapons.
The
Litvinov Ruse - Carrie contacts Saul and informs him of Allison's
treachery and they must now find hard evidence.
New
Normal - Islamic terrorists begin to plan and prepare their
attack with Sarin gas.
Our
Man in Damascus - Saul and Carrie searches for where the
terrorist might plan to deploy the Sarin gas.
A
False Glimmer - Carrie manages to stop the terrorist attack. Saul
black bags Allison and offers Carrie a position to return to the CIA,
but she refuses. And all is at right with the world ...for now.
